Using a Null Object pattern in VBA Polymorphic classes

by Jonathan Halder | May 1, 2025 | Blogging, MS Access, MS Access Features, MS Access VBA Coding

If you have an interface class object and you implement several types of the object, what can you do when your object has no handler? That’s where the Null Object pattern comes into play. Here’s an example of how you could implement the Null Object Design...

Dragging and dropping between Access Files

by Jonathan Halder | Mar 27, 2025 | Blogging, MS Access, MS Access Features, MS Access Forms, MS Access Queries, MS Access Reports, MS Access Tables, MS Access VBA Coding

Did you know that you can drag and drop items from the navigation pane in one Access database to another Access database? I used this feature today as I needed to copy a somewhat complex form to display a series of entries in a linked table in both databases filtered...
